, How long after the virus enters the bloodstream does it take for the body to require the
number of antibodies necessary for detection? ✅Between 25 days and 3 months.
What does EIA detect? ✅HIV antibodies
What does a Western Blot detect? ✅HIV antibodies and confirms EIA
What is a Viral load? ✅Measures HIV RNA in plasma
What is CD4/CD8? ✅Markers that are found on lymphocytes; results in significant
impairment of immune system. (T-helper cells will be down).
What is an OraQuick? ✅In-Home HIV test
What are systemic symptoms of HIV? ✅Fever and weight loss
What are pharyngitis symptoms of HIV infection? ✅Mouth sores and thrush
What are esophagus symptoms of HIV? ✅Sores
What are muscle symptoms for HIV? ✅Myalgia
What are liver and spleen symptoms of HIV? ✅Enlargement
What are central symptoms of HIV? ✅Malaise
Headache
Neuropathy
What are lymph nodes symptoms of HIV? ✅Lymphadenopathy
What is a skin symptom for HIV? ✅Rash
What is gastric symptoms for HIV? ✅Nausea and Vomiting
